:I've installed freebsd 4.0 as contained in The Complete FreeBSD Book.
:
:I've configured KDE kfm and Netscape so they can work through the proxy/firewall used at which I am working.
:
:However, I can not find documentation on how to use make and make install through a firewall/proxy when when building a port.
:
:/stand/sysinstall ftp proxy - firewall does not work.
:
:Neither does the ftp command.
:
:I can use Netscape and KDE kfm to download files, but its getting very old.
:
:Please direct me to documentation.

set the HTTP_PROXY variable to point to your proxy.  man fetch should tell
you what you want to know.
